Product Overview: PIC16F18323-E/SL
The PIC16F18323-E/SL is a high-performance microcontroller unit (MCU) from Microchip Technology, renowned for its versatility and efficiency in a multitude of electronic applications. This particular model is part of the expansive PIC16F family, which is well-regarded for its ease of use and robust feature set tailored for a variety of tasks ranging from simple to complex.
The PIC16F18323-E/SL operates with an enhanced mid-range 8-bit architecture and includes a 32 MHz internal oscillator. Its design allows for low-power consumption while maintaining reliable performance, making it an ideal choice for battery-powered and power-sensitive applications. The device comes in a 14-pin SOIC package, which is suitable for space-constrained designs.
Among its key features, this MCU boasts 3.5 KB of flash memory and 256 bytes of EEPROM, providing ample space for application code and data storage. It is further equipped with 512 bytes of RAM, ensuring smooth operation and data handling. The MCU supports a wide operating voltage range from 2.3V to 5.5V, allowing for flexibility in various power supply conditions.
Connectivity and interface options are robust on the PIC16F18323-E/SL. It includes a versatile set of peripherals such as I2C, SPI, and UART serial communication modules, which are essential for modern embedded systems that require communication with sensors, actuators, or other microcontrollers. Additionally, it features a 10-bit Analog-to-Digital Converter (ADC) with Computation (ADC2) for precise analog signal measurement and processing.
For applications requiring accurate timing and control, the device is equipped with multiple timers and PWM modules. It also supports various low-power modes, making it ideal for energy-efficient designs. The MCU's eXtreme Low-Power (XLP) technology ensures that it can maintain functionality while consuming minimal power, which is critical for prolonging battery life in portable devices.
